Halo


《JavaScript在浙江工业大学创新实践项目中的应用》 浙江工业大学创新实践项目中,JavaScript作为一种重要的编程语言,发挥着不可或缺的角色。JavaScript,简称JS,是Web开发领域最常用的脚本语言,尤其在网络应用方面,其功能强大,灵活性高,使得它成为构建交互式网页的关键工具。 在Ver 0.8版本中,JavaScript的应用主要体现在以下几个方面: 1. **前端交互**:JavaScript主要用于网页的动态效果和用户交互。它可以实时更新页面内容,比如动态加载数据、响应用户点击事件、实现表单验证等,大大提高了用户体验。 2. **DOM操作**:Document Object Model(DOM)是HTML和XML文档的结构化表示。JavaScript可以操作DOM,添加、删除或修改页面元素,实现页面动态更新和内容的实时交互。 3. **AJAX异步通信**:在Ver 0.8项目中,JavaScript通过AJAX(Asynchronous JavaScript and XML)技术实现页面与服务器的异步数据交换,无须刷新整个页面即可获取或更新信息,提升了页面性能和用户体验。 4. **框架与库的应用**:考虑到项目复杂性,JavaScript的库和框架如jQuery、React、Vue等可能被引入,它们提供了一套更高级别的API,简化了代码编写,增强了代码复用性,同时降低了开发难度。 5. **模块化开发**:随着项目规模的扩大,JavaScript的模块化管理变得至关重要。CommonJS、AMD(Asynchronous Module Definition)或者ES6的模块系统可能被采用,帮助组织和管理代码,提高代码的可维护性和可读性。 6. **浏览器兼容性处理**:JavaScript的执行环境因浏览器而异,项目中可能运用了polyfill或条件语句来确保代码在不同浏览器上的兼容性,保证所有用户都能正常访问和使用。 7. **性能优化**:在Ver 0.8版本中,JavaScript的性能优化也是关键。包括合理使用闭包、避免内存泄漏、减少DOM操作、利用事件委托等策略,都是为了提升程序运行效率。 8. **错误处理与调试**:JavaScript的错误处理机制,如try...catch结构,以及使用console.log()进行调试,对于发现并修复问题,保证项目的稳定运行至关重要。 9. **安全考虑**:JavaScript在处理用户输入时,需要防止XSS(Cross-site scripting)攻击,通过转义特殊字符,验证输入等方式保障数据的安全。 10. **移动优先**:考虑到现代互联网的多设备访问特性,JavaScript在实现响应式设计、触屏事件处理等方面也扮演着重要角色,确保项目在手机、平板等移动设备上同样运行流畅。 JavaScript在浙江工业大学创新实践项目Ver 0.8中扮演了核心角色,从用户交互、数据通信到性能优化,都体现了其强大的功能和灵活性。随着技术的不断发展,JavaScript将继续在未来的项目中发挥更加重要的作用。

































































































































- 1
- 2
- 3
- 4


- 粉丝: 30
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 主要是在学习李航的统计学习方法和周志华的机器学习西瓜书的笔记和相关的代码实现
- 单片机技术试题集.doc
- 基于卷积神经网络的图像分类技术.docx
- JavaEE物联网云计算系列培训教材-Oracle数据库设计01.ppt
- 《计算机应用基础Windows-xp》综合练习.doc
- 清大学习吧项目管理手册汇编.doc
- 基于单片机的数字秒表系统研究设计.doc
- 数字图像处理期末考试答案.docx
- 中职服装专业课堂教学信息化探究.docx
- 创客教育在《计算机应用基础》课程教学中的应用.docx
- 大数据时代高校资产管理信息化建设研究.docx
- BIM+智慧工地的项目管理模式探究.docx
- 论网络虚拟财产的刑法保护.docx
- 计算机网络安全防范策略.docx
- 【高中信息技术课件】算法及其实现.ppt
- 国内外大数据下政策评估研究综述.docx


